Huntington Falls To Garden City In LI Baseball Championship Game

The Blue Devils emerged as the best team in Suffolk County but could not take home the Long Island championship on Sunday.

UNIONDALE, NY — The Huntington High School baseball team's magical run came to a halt on Sunday.

The Blue Devils, after winning the Suffolk championship for the first time since 1960, lost to Garden City for the Long Island Conference II championship game, 5-3, according to the Huntington Union Free School District.

Huntington's Suffolk title was earned in a 7-4 Blue Devils win over Bay Shore.
